To gain admission to the MBA Dual programme at PUMBA (Department of Management Sciences, Savitribai Phule Pune University) through the CMAT exam, you first need a valid CMAT score. After the CMAT results are out, you must apply to PUMBA. The selection process typically involves a Group Discussion (GD) and Personal Interview (PI) round, which assesses your communication skills, leadership potential, and general awareness. Your final merit will be a composite score, usually giving significant weightage to CMAT, along to your GD/PI performance and academic record.

With 88 percentile in MBA CET and coming from general category it's unlikely to get an admission in PUMBA. PUMBA cutoff through CET for general category students is usually around 98 to 99 percentile.There is immense competition and all the seats are usually taken by top scorers. You can apply and get involved in the CAP rounds, because the cut off may differ slightly every year. You should also consider applying at other reputable colleges in Maharashtra accepting CET scores as there may be colleges with little lower cutoff. Stay ready with backup options.
